Ep 36. The Gender Pain Gap 20.01.2026

The Shallow Take? Endometriosis is just bad period pain... But, really... Endometriosis affects around 190 million people worldwide (World Health Organisation). In the UK, 1 in 10 women live with it (that's about 1.5 million people - Endometriosis UK). And yet, the average diagnosis still takes years. Why?
